In Google\u2019s AI-driven search environment, technical signals determine whether your pages are even considered for visibility. If a website cannot be crawled efficiently, rendered correctly, or structured in a way search engines understand, even high-quality content may struggle to appear in search results. Backlinko\u2019s study of roughly 4 million results shows the #1 organic result gets a 27.6% CTR, while only 0.63% of searchers click anything on page two.<\/p>\n<p>On top of that, more and more decisions never reach your website at all. Semrush reports that 58.5% of U.S. searches in 2024 ended without a single click, with AI Overviews and rich SERP features answering questions directly on the results page. That means the sites with a clean structure, clear entities, and strong <strong>AI-driven SEO signals<\/strong> are surfaced within those experiences; everyone else becomes invisible background noise. Do that well, and every blog, landing page, and product detail you ship has a far better chance of being trusted by humans and algorithms.<\/p>\n<h2>Can Google Crawl Without Wasting Energy?<\/h2>\n<p>Google does not crawl your website with endless patience or unlimited resources. If bots keep landing on duplicate pages, weak archives, broken paths, or messy parameter URLs, you are wasting crawl attention on content that adds no real value. That becomes a problem because the more time Google spends sorting through noise, the less efficiently it can discover, refresh, and prioritize the pages that actually matter for search visibility.<\/p>\n<h3><strong>What helps most:<\/strong><\/h3>\n<ul>\n<li><strong>Reduce duplicate and parameter-heavy URLs<\/strong> so crawlers are not sent through endless versions of the same page.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Keep your XML sitemap focused<\/strong> on clean, indexable, high-value pages instead of dumping in everything your CMS generates.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Strengthen internal linking to key pages<\/strong> so important content is easy to reach and clearly signaled as valuable.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Review crawl patterns through logs or audits<\/strong> to spot where Googlebot is wasting time.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p>When crawl paths are clean, Google spends less energy filtering clutter and more energy understanding your strongest content. That is the real win. Better crawling is not some technical vanity metric. It directly affects how consistently your important pages get found, revisited, and taken seriously by search engines.<\/p>\n<p><img decoding=\"async\" class=\"aligncenter wp-image-4420 size-full\" src=\"https:\/\/www.esignwebservices.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/04\/Can-Google-Crawl-You-Without-Wasting-Energy.jpg\" alt=\"Can Google Crawl You Without Wasting Energy\" width=\"1536\" height=\"899\" srcset=\"https:\/\/www.esignwebservices.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/04\/Can-Google-Crawl-You-Without-Wasting-Energy.jpg 1536w, https:\/\/www.esignwebservices.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/04\/Can-Google-Crawl-You-Without-Wasting-Energy-300x176.jpg 300w, https:\/\/www.esignwebservices.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/04\/Can-Google-Crawl-You-Without-Wasting-Energy-768x450.jpg 768w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 1536px) 100vw, 1536px\" \/><\/p>\n<h2>Are Pages Indexed Or Just Reachable?<\/h2>\n<p>A page can be easy to crawl and still not qualify for indexing. Indexing acts as a quality filter, and search engines rely on indexation signals to determine whether a page deserves to appear in search results. Thin tag pages, slight city or product variations, and low-value archives dilute the strength of your overall library. When you add conflicting canonicals, mismatched sitemaps, and sloppy internal links on top, you end up sending mixed <strong>technical SEO signals<\/strong> and essentially dare Google to guess which URL you actually care about. When systems have to guess, they rarely choose the version you\u2019d pitch in a meeting.<\/p>\n<p>Index bloat is usually self-inflicted. Many sites unintentionally create large numbers of filter pages, archives, and internal search URLs. While this increases the number of indexed pages, it rarely improves visibility. Instead, it spreads ranking signals across low-value pages, weakening the overall quality of the index. It doesn\u2019t. It just drags down the average quality of what you\u2019re offering. <a href=\"https:\/\/searchengineland.com\/guide\/crawlability\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"no follow noopener\"><strong>Smart crawlability optimization<\/strong><\/a> accepts that not every URL should compete in organic search. Removing or no indexing weak pages lets Google focus its evaluation and crawl resources on your best work instead of your leftovers. A leaner index also makes your site look more like a curated library and less like a random content dump.<\/p>\n<p>Canonicals are supposed to be the referee, but they only work when the rest of your setup backs them up. If the canonical tag points to one URL, internal links push another, and the sitemap lists a third, you\u2019ve turned a simple hierarchy into an argument. The fix is boring but crystal clear: pick one canonical per intent and align links, sitemaps, and redirects around it. Once everything points in the same direction, your <strong>technical SEO signals<\/strong> stop contradicting each other and start backing one strong, authoritative version.<\/p>\n<p><strong>Index quality list<\/strong><\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>Export all indexed URLs; tag filters, archives, and duplicates for cleanup.<\/li>\n<li>Consolidate near-duplicate pages into a single, clear canonical per topic.<\/li>\n<li>Limit the sitemap to pages you\u2019d be happy to walk a high-value prospect through.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h3><strong>Index Quality Comparison Table<\/strong><\/h3>\n<table style=\"height: 235px; width: 99.865%; border-collapse: collapse; border-style: solid; border-color: #000000; background-color: #0c962a;\" border=\"1\">\n<tbody>\n<tr style=\"height: 56px;\">\n<td style=\"width: 28.6107%; height: 56px; text-align: center;\"><span style=\"color: #ffffff;\"><strong>URL Type<\/strong><\/span><\/td>\n<td style=\"width: 16.4635%; height: 56px; text-align: center;\"><span style=\"color: #ffffff;\"><strong>Current Count<\/strong><\/span><\/td>\n<td style=\"width: 14.0351%; height: 56px; text-align: center;\"><span style=\"color: #ffffff;\"><strong>Ideal Range<\/strong><\/span><\/td>\n<td style=\"width: 27.2605%; height: 56px; text-align: center;\"><span style=\"color: #ffffff;\"><strong>What It Tells Google<\/strong><\/span><\/td>\n<td style=\"width: 13.4953%; height: 56px; text-align: center;\"><span style=\"color: #ffffff;\"><strong>Fix Priority<\/strong><\/span><\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r style=\"height: 56px;\">\n<td style=\"width: 28.6107%; height: 47px; text-align: center;\"><span style=\"color: #ffffff;\"><strong>High-intent pages<\/strong><\/span><\/td>\n<td style=\"width: 16.4635%; height: 47px; background-color: #f7f7f7; text-align: center;\">80<\/td>\n<td style=\"width: 14.0351%; height: 47px; background-color: #f7f7f7; text-align: center;\">120\u2013150<\/td>\n<td style=\"width: 27.2605%; height: 47px; background-color: #f7f7f7; text-align: center;\">Focused, but underserving<\/td>\n<td style=\"width: 13.4953%; height: 47px; background-color: #f7f7f7; text-align: center;\">Medium<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r style=\"height: 56px;\">\n<td style=\"width: 28.6107%; height: 46px; text-align: center;\"><span style=\"color: #ffffff;\"><strong>Thin\/tag\/archive pages<\/strong><\/span><\/td>\n<td style=\"width: 16.4635%; height: 46px; background-color: #f7f7f7; text-align: center;\">260<\/td>\n<td style=\"width: 14.0351%; height: 46px; background-color: #f7f7f7; text-align: center;\">&lt; 50<\/td>\n<td style=\"width: 27.2605%; height: 46px; background-color: #f7f7f7; text-align: center;\">Bloated, low-value index<\/td>\n<td style=\"width: 13.4953%; height: 46px; background-color: #f7f7f7; text-align: center;\">Very High<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r style=\"height: 56px;\">\n<td style=\"width: 28.6107%; height: 49px; text-align: center;\"><span style=\"color: #ffffff;\"><strong>Parameter\/search URLs<\/strong><\/span><\/td>\n<td style=\"width: 16.4635%; height: 49px; background-color: #f7f7f7; text-align: center;\">140<\/td>\n<td style=\"width: 14.0351%; height: 49px; background-color: #f7f7f7; text-align: center;\">0\u201310<\/td>\n<td style=\"width: 27.2605%; height: 49px; background-color: #f7f7f7; text-align: center;\">Wasted crawl, noisy signals<\/td>\n<td style=\"width: 13.4953%; height: 49px; background-color: #f7f7f7; text-align: center;\">High<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r style=\"height: 56px;\">\n<td style=\"width: 28.6107%; height: 37px; text-align: center;\"><span style=\"color: #ffffff;\"><strong>Total indexed URLs<\/strong><\/span><\/td>\n<td style=\"width: 16.4635%; height: 37px; background-color: #f7f7f7; text-align: center;\">480<\/td>\n<td style=\"width: 14.0351%; height: 37px; background-color: #f7f7f7; text-align: center;\">~200<\/td>\n<td style=\"width: 27.2605%; height: 37px; background-color: #f7f7f7; text-align: center;\">Quantity over clarity<\/td>\n<td style=\"width: 13.4953%; height: 37px; background-color: #f7f7f7; text-align: center;\">High<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<\/tbody>\n<\/table>\n<div style=\"background-color: #e69605; border-left: 5px solid #ffa500; padding: 14px; margin: 20px 0; color: white;\"><em><strong>Warning (Callout):<\/strong> If most of your indexed URLs are pages you\u2019d never show in a live demo, don\u2019t blame the algorithm when rankings feel shaky.<\/em><\/div>\n<h2><strong>Does Google See the Same Page Users See?<\/strong><\/h2>\n<p>On modern sites, rendering is the real gatekeeper. A page that appears complete in a browser may still present an incomplete version to search engines if important content, links, or structured data load only after JavaScript execution or user interaction. That\u2019s a serious problem in a world where <strong>Google AI ranking factors<\/strong> put a lot of weight on clarity and reusability. When the rendered HTML is thin, your <strong>technical SEO signals<\/strong> effectively say \u201cuncertain source,\u201d so AI systems are less likely to quote or surface you, even if human visitors eventually see a beautiful, fully loaded version.<\/p>\n<p>The safer approach is to make sure your main story lives in HTML before any fancy scripts run. Headings, core copy, primary internal links, and markup should all be visible to a non-JavaScript client. That\u2019s where <strong>semantic HTML structure<\/strong> still quietly pulls its weight. If critical information only appears after complex front-end components load, search engines may struggle to interpret the page correctly. Prioritizing accessible HTML structure ensures that both users and crawlers can immediately understand the page\u2019s core message. AI can\u2019t reliably reuse what it can\u2019t reliably render, and you don\u2019t get bonus points for clever front-end engineering that hides meaning from crawlers.<\/p>\n<p>Instead of trusting how the site feels on your laptop, test the way a bot experiences it. Use tools that render HTML, compare the \u201cview source\u201d to what Google actually sees, and look for blocked or missing resources. If critical sections vanish when JavaScript fails, that\u2019s not a tiny edge case\u2014that\u2019s a structural flaw. Fixing those gaps is one of the quickest ways to strengthen <a href=\"https:\/\/www.esignwebservices.com\/blog\/geo-optimizing-for-ai-driven-search-results\/\"><strong>AI-driven SEO signals<\/strong><\/a> without touching a sentence of copy. The goal isn\u2019t to ban JavaScript; it\u2019s to make sure that even if everything dynamic broke tomorrow, the page would still make sense.<\/p>\n<h3><strong>Render reality check<\/strong><\/h3>\n<ul>\n<li>Capture rendered HTML for key URLs and confirm all critical content appears.<\/li>\n<li>Refactor components that hide core text or links behind interactions.<\/li>\n<li>Make sure resources needed for rendering aren\u2019t blocked or misconfigured.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<div style=\"background-color: #0c962a; border-left: 5px solid #086c20; padding: 14px; margin: 20px 0; color: white;\"><em><strong><strong>Quick Tip: <\/strong><\/strong>Load a high-value page with JavaScript disabled. If the offer isn\u2019t obvious in a few seconds, you\u2019ve just seen what the crawler is struggling with.<\/em><\/div>\n<p><img decoding=\"async\" class=\"aligncenter wp-image-4421 size-full\" src=\"https:\/\/www.esignwebservices.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/04\/Does-Google-See-the-Same-Page-Users-See.jpg\" alt=\"Does Google See the Same Page Users See \" width=\"1536\" height=\"1024\" srcset=\"https:\/\/www.esignwebservices.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/04\/Does-Google-See-the-Same-Page-Users-See.jpg 1536w, https:\/\/www.esignwebservices.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/04\/Does-Google-See-the-Same-Page-Users-See-300x200.jpg 300w, https:\/\/www.esignwebservices.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/04\/Does-Google-See-the-Same-Page-Users-See-768x512.jpg 768w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 1536px) 100vw, 1536px\" \/><\/p>\n<h2>Can Machines Understand Without Guessing?<\/h2>\n<p>Search engines and AI systems are advanced, but they still work best when your website makes meaning obvious. Google\u2019s <strong>Core Web Vitals<\/strong> guidelines suggest aiming for LCP \u2264 2.5s, INP \u2264 200ms, and CLS \u2264 0.1 at the 75th percentile of page views. When you hit those marks, the experience feels dependable; when you don\u2019t, it feels sloppy. That perceived reliability feeds into <strong>page experience ranking<\/strong> considerations and into broader <strong>technical SEO signals<\/strong>, indicating to AI systems that your site is low-friction. Slow, unstable pages don\u2019t just annoy users, they actively waste your visibility opportunities.<\/p>\n<p>Responsiveness is where many sites quietly fall behind. CrUX data behind INP thresholds shows that only a minority of popular phone origins reliably hit the 200ms \u201cgood\u201d threshold, and performance worsens as pages become more complex. Meanwhile, user patience is brutally short: several studies show that around 53% of mobile users bail out if a page takes longer than three seconds to load. If your page \u201clooks loaded\u201d but feels sluggish every time someone taps, scrolls, or types, users\u2014and any <strong>Google AI ranking factors<\/strong> tied to engagement\u2014will move on without ceremony.<\/p>\n<p>Mobile isn\u2019t a segment anymore; it\u2019s the default context. More than half of global web traffic now comes from mobile devices, and bounce rates can jump by 30% or more as load time increases from 1 to 3 seconds. For <a href=\"https:\/\/www.esignwebservices.com\/blog\/advanced-on-page-seo-techniques-2026\/\"><strong>technical SEO 2026<\/strong><\/a>, the to-do list is straightforward even if the work isn\u2019t: strip out heavy third-party scripts, compress and modernize images, optimize fonts, and keep layouts stable while assets load. Tackling the single worst performance offender on each high-value page often does more for real users\u2014and for search\u2014than chasing tiny gains across everything at once.<\/p>\n<h3><strong>Performance leak map<\/strong><\/h3>\n<ul>\n<li>Identify your top 10 organic + revenue landing pages.<\/li>\n<li>For each one, decide whether LCP, INP, or CLS is the main problem.<\/li>\n<li>Fix that one metric first (images, JS bloat, fonts, or layout shifts).<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<div style=\"background-color: #0c962a; border-left: 5px solid #086c20; padding: 14px; margin: 20px 0; color: white;\"><em><strong><strong>Quick Win (Callout): <\/strong><\/strong>Remove one heavy script or widget from a high-intent page and re-run Web Vitals\u2014interaction responsiveness, engagement, and conversions often lift together faster than you expect.<\/em><\/div>\n<p><img decoding=\"async\" class=\"aligncenter wp-image-4423 size-full\" src=\"https:\/\/www.esignwebservices.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/04\/Is-Your-Site-Fast-Stable-and-Interaction-Friendly.png\" alt=\"Is-Your-Site-Fast-Stable-and-Interaction-Friendly\" width=\"954\" height=\"682\" srcset=\"https:\/\/www.esignwebservices.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/04\/Is-Your-Site-Fast-Stable-and-Interaction-Friendly.png 954w, https:\/\/www.esignwebservices.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/04\/Is-Your-Site-Fast-Stable-and-Interaction-Friendly-300x214.png 300w, https:\/\/www.esignwebservices.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/04\/Is-Your-Site-Fast-Stable-and-Interaction-Friendly-768x549.png 768w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 954px) 100vw, 954px\" \/><\/p>\n<h2>Same Language Everywhere You Operate?<\/h2>\n<p>International SEO often looks fine on the surface while quietly failing beneath the surface. When hub pages, in-depth articles, and decision-stage pages all connect logically, you\u2019re sketching a clear, crawlable map of your expertise. That map is one of the strongest <strong>AI-driven SEO signals<\/strong> you control: it shows which topics you cover deeply and how someone should move from \u201cjust researching\u201d to \u201cready to choose.\u201d Without it, even great content looks like isolated islands,and isolated islands send very weak <strong>technical SEO signals<\/strong> about real authority.<\/p>\n<p>The place to start is usually not glamorous: fix orphan pages and tame noisy links. Orphans\u2014pages with zero or one internal link, almost never perform, no matter how optimized the on-page content is. Pages stuffed with dozens of random links lose focus. A stronger internal linking structure guides users from educational content to comparison resources and finally to decision or conversion pages. That pattern not only matches how people decide, but also reinforces <a href=\"https:\/\/backlinko.com\/hub\/seo\/architecture\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"no follow noopener\"><strong>site architecture SEO<\/strong><\/a>, because related topics naturally cluster rather than being thrown into a flat heap.<\/p>\n<p>Breadcrumbs and contextual links behave like a two-engine system. Breadcrumbs quietly answer \u201cwhere am I on this site?\u201d while in-text and end-of-page links answer \u201cwhat\u2019s the smartest thing to look at next?\u201d Over time, those patterns make your domain a safer bet when systems assemble answers, overviews, and recommendations\u2014that\u2019s the compounding effect of smarter <strong>AI search optimization<\/strong>. If navigation feels clean and obvious to humans, there\u2019s a very good chance you\u2019ve also made life easier for crawlers, which is exactly what you want.<\/p>\n<h3><strong>Link cleanup sprint<\/strong><\/h3>\n<ul>\n<li>Find pages with zero or one internal link and connect them to relevant hubs.<\/li>\n<li>Turn top guides into mini-hubs with 3\u20135 focused \u201cnext step\u201d links.<\/li>\n<li>Add breadcrumbs to core templates and walk real users through their journeys to see how they feel.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p><img decoding=\"async\" class=\"aligncenter wp-image-4425 size-full\" src=\"https:\/\/www.esignwebservices.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/04\/Is-Your-Internal-Linking-Teaching-the-Algorithm.png\" alt=\"Is-Your-Internal-Linking-Teaching-the-Algorithm\" width=\"1024\" height=\"768\" srcset=\"https:\/\/www.esignwebservices.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/04\/Is-Your-Internal-Linking-Teaching-the-Algorithm.png 1024w, https:\/\/www.esignwebservices.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/04\/Is-Your-Internal-Linking-Teaching-the-Algorithm-300x225.png 300w, https:\/\/www.esignwebservices.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/04\/Is-Your-Internal-Linking-Teaching-the-Algorithm-768x576.png 768w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 1024px) 100vw, 1024px\" \/><\/p>\n<h2><strong>Conclusion: AI Visibility via Technical SEO<\/strong><\/h2>\n<p>Under every consistently high-performing site in Google\u2019s AI era, you\u2019ll find the same thing: a clean, disciplined technical foundation. Google can render JavaScript, but rendering is resource-intensive and not always consistent across sites, templates, and crawl states. If your main content, internal links, or structured data only appear after delayed scripts or user interactions, Google may index an incomplete version. That hurts both rankings and AI reuse. Reduce risk by ensuring critical content appears in initial HTML or renders reliably, keeping resources crawlable, and validating with rendered HTML checks in Search Console.<\/p>\n<p><strong>Question: Does mobile-first indexing impact AI search inclusion?<\/strong><\/p>\n<p><strong>Answer:<\/strong> Yes, mobile-first indexing directly affects AI interpretation and inclusion.
